Fast Facts for Physical Therapists in Pennsylvania

  • Cities with highest percentage of jobs relative to population: Erie, Williamsport, and Reading
  • Cities with lowest percentage of jobs relative to population: Lebanon, State College, and Altoona
  • Cities with the highest absolute number of jobs: Philadelphia, Pittsburgh, and Allentown

Salaries for Physical Therapists in Pennsylvania

  • Metro areas with the highest median salaries: Harrisburg, Lancaster, and Williamsport. (See table at bottom of page)

Job Popularity in Metro Areas for Physical Therapists

The map below shows job statistics for the career type by metro area, for Pennsylvania. A table below the map shows job popularity and salaries across the state.

Metro Areas Rated for Popularity (as of 2008) for:
Physical Therapists

Listed below are metro areas ranked by the popularity of jobs for Physical Therapists relative to the population of the city, as of 2008. Salary data was obtained from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ics.

A Relative Popularity of 1.0 means that the city has an average number of the particular job, for its population, compared to the rest of the US. Higher numbers mean proportionally more jobs of that type.
Metro AreaJobsSalary
(2008)
Relative
Popularity

PENNSYLVANIA

   
Erie310$73,6102.1
Williamsport100$78,9801.8
Reading310$74,5901.5
Allentown550$74,0401.3
Philadelphia3,020$73,9401.2
York270$72,7801.2
Pittsburgh1,780$68,8001.2
Harrisburg470$80,8801.2
Scranton370$68,1201.2
Lancaster290$79,8501
Altoona60$70,8000.9
State College50$68,9000.8
Lebanon40$70,0300.8
